About

Jinxing Quan is a scholar working on Molecular Biology, Immunology and Surgery. According to data from OpenAlex, Jinxing Quan has authored 41 papers receiving a total of 514 indexed citations (citations by other indexed papers that have themselves been cited), including 21 papers in Molecular Biology, 8 papers in Immunology and 7 papers in Surgery. Recurrent topics in Jinxing Quan's work include Cell Adhesion Molecules Research (6 papers), Atherosclerosis and Cardiovascular Diseases (4 papers) and Bone Metabolism and Diseases (4 papers). Jinxing Quan is often cited by papers focused on Cell Adhesion Molecules Research (6 papers), Atherosclerosis and Cardiovascular Diseases (4 papers) and Bone Metabolism and Diseases (4 papers). Jinxing Quan collaborates with scholars based in China and Denmark. Jinxing Quan's co-authors include Juxiang Liu, Qi Zhang, Limin Tian, Youpeng Li, Xingguang Liu, Ruifei Yang, Yunfang Wang, Jing Liu, Jia Liu and Yaqiong Zhang and has published in prestigious journals such as Analytical Biochemistry, Biochemical and Biophysical Research Communications and Gene.
